Business Continuity Management and ISO 22301

ISO/IEC 22301 is an international standard that specifies requirements for establishing,implementing, operating, monitoring, reviewing, maintaining, and continually improving a Business Continuity Management System (BCMS). This standard is part of the ISO 22300 family, which focuses on societal security, resilience, and emergency management
Business Continuity Management (BCM) is a strategic approach that organizations adopt to ensure the continuation of their essential business functions during and after disruptions or crises. These disruptions can be caused by various factors, including natural disasters, cybersecurity incidents, supply chain failures, or other unexpected events. The primary goal of BCM is to minimize the impact of these disruptions on an organization's operations, reputation, and stakeholder interests.

Understanding ISO/IEC 22301

ISO 22301:2019 Certification is a crucial component of BCMS. It provides a globally recognized framework for Business Continuity Management Systems (BCMS). This standard outlines the requirements and best practices for establishing, implementing, operating, monitoring, reviewing, maintaining, and continually improving a BCMS within an organization.
ISO/IEC 22301 is designed to help organizations of all sizes and types ensure the continuity of their critical operations and services during and after disruptive incidents. These incidents can include natural disasters, cyberattacks, power outages, supply chain disruptions, and other unexpected events. By adhering to ISO/IEC 22301, organizations can systematically identify potential threats, assess their impact, and develop strategies and plans to mitigate risks and maintain business continuity.

Who Should Implement ISO/IEC 22301?

ISO/IEC 22301, as a globally recognized standard for business continuity management, holds paramount significance for organizations across diverse sectors.
This standard is pertinent to large corporations, where complex structures and extensive stakeholder networks necessitate a structured approach to business continuity. Simultaneously, it proves equally valuable for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s), offering them a cost-effective framework to fortify their operations. Additionally, public sector entities rely on ISO 22301 to sustain critical services, while service providers and entities within supply chains leverage it to guarantee uninterrupted service delivery and meet clients demands.
It serves as a vital tool for those committed to ensuring the resilience and continuity of their operations in the face of disruptions, be it due to natural disasters, cyberattacks, or other unforeseen events.
